CVE-2026-4281 is a Missing Authorization vulnerability affecting all versions up to 7.5.21 of the FormLift for Infusionsoft Web Forms plugin for WordPress. This flaw allows unauthenticated attackers to hijack the site's Infusionsoft connection by redirecting its API communication to an attacker-controlled server. Rated Medium with a CVSS score of 5.3, the vulnerability has low attack complexity and requires no user interaction. There is currently no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code, or significant community discussion or media coverage for this CVE.
